Betting progressions, it is universally agreed, do not provide you with a long-term advantage over the casino in the game of independent trials. They do transform the distribution of wins and losses. Which can make them excellent for process sellers who can say a thing "you will win seventy-five % of all sessions" in value honesty. I can do improved than that. Test doubling your wager each and every time you lose. Then you might win all of the sessions. Except for one, that can be the one by which you lose everything.
